Learn keyfacts about NVQ Clinical Aesthetic Injectable Therapies Course
The NVQ Clinical Aesthetic Injectable Therapies Course is designed to equip participants with the necessary skills and knowledge to perform aesthetic injectable treatments safely and effectively. The course covers a range of injectable therapies, including dermal fillers and botulinum toxin injections, to enhance facial aesthetics and address various skin concerns.
Participants will learn how to conduct thorough client consultations, assess treatment suitability, and administer injectable therapies with precision. The course also emphasizes the importance of infection control, client safety, and ethical practice in the field of aesthetic medicine.
The duration of the NVQ Clinical Aesthetic Injectable Therapies Course typically ranges from several weeks to a few months, depending on the training provider and the mode of delivery. Participants can expect a combination of theoretical learning, practical training, and assessments to ensure competency in performing aesthetic injectable treatments.
